"यदि कोई कर्मचारी अपना काम अच्छी तरह से करना चाहता है, तो उसे पहले अपने औजारों को तेज करना होगा।" - कन्फ्यूशियस, "द एनालेक्ट्स ऑफ कन्फ्यूशियस। लू लिंगगोंग"
मुखपृष्ठ > प्रोग्रामिंग > रिएक्ट में वस्तुओं की एक श्रृंखला कैसे प्रस्तुत करें?

रिएक्ट में वस्तुओं की एक श्रृंखला कैसे प्रस्तुत करें?

2024-11-25 को प्रकाशित
ब्राउज़ करें:698

How to Render an Array of Objects in React?

रिएक्ट में ऑब्जेक्ट्स की एक सरणी प्रस्तुत करना

क्वेरी रिएक्ट में ऑब्जेक्ट्स की एक सूची प्रस्तुत करने का प्रयास दर्शाती है। हालाँकि, इसमें रेंडर() विधि के भीतर आवश्यक रिटर्न स्टेटमेंट गायब है। आइए इसे संबोधित करें और एक व्यापक समाधान प्रदान करें:

समाधान:

रिएक्ट में वस्तुओं की एक श्रृंखला प्रस्तुत करने के लिए, दो दृष्टिकोण हैं:

विधि 1: आउटपुट को एक वेरिएबल में संग्रहीत करें

render() {
    const data =[{"name":"test1"},{"name":"test2"}];
    const listItems = data.map((d) => 
  • {d.name}
  • ); return (
    {listItems }
    ); }

    विधि 2: सीधे रिटर्न में मैप फ़ंक्शन लिखें

    render() {
        const data =[{"name":"test1"},{"name":"test2"}];
        return (
          
    {data.map(function(d, idx){ return (
  • {d.name}
  • ) })}
    ); }

    दोनों तरीकों में, डेटा को तत्वों की सूची में मैप किया जाता है। जैसा कि रिएक्ट द्वारा आवश्यक है, प्रत्येक तत्व को एक अद्वितीय कुंजी प्रोप सौंपा गया है। यह कुंजी कुशल पुन: प्रतिपादन सुनिश्चित करती है और प्रत्येक सूची आइटम की पहचान बनाए रखती है।

    ये समाधान रिएक्ट में वस्तुओं की सारणी को प्रस्तुत करने के लिए एक विश्वसनीय और लचीला तरीका प्रदान करते हैं।

    नवीनतम ट्यूटोरियल अधिक>

    चीनी भाषा का अध्ययन करें

    अस्वीकरण: उपलब्ध कराए गए सभी संसाधन आंशिक रूप से इंटरनेट से हैं। यदि आपके कॉपीराइट या अन्य अधिकारों और हितों का कोई उल्लंघन होता है, तो कृपया विस्तृत कारण बताएं और कॉपीराइट या अधिकारों और हितों का प्रमाण प्रदान करें और फिर इसे ईमेल पर भेजें: [email protected] हम इसे आपके लिए यथाशीघ्र संभालेंगे।

    Copyright© 2022 湘ICP备2022001581号-3